titleOfInvention |
Polyolefin wax for coating materials and printing ink composition |
abstract |
A polyolefin wax for a coating material which includes an ethylene (co)polymer having a number-average molecular weight within the range of from 400 to 5000 as measured by gel permeation chromatography. The polyolefin wax has a volume average particle diameter in the range of from 0.3 μm to 20 μm wherein the relation between a particle diameter a (μm), in which the weight ratio of the large particle diameter side in weight particle-size distribution is 10%, and a particle diameter b (μm), in which the weight ratio of the small particle diameter side in weight particle size distribution is 10%, satisfies the a/b≦4 and the relation between the crystallization temperature Tc (° C.), measured at a cooling rate of 2° C./min) as measured by differential scanning calorimetry (DSC) and the density D (kg/m 3 ) as measured by the density gradient tube method satisfies the equation 0.501×D−366≧Tc. A printing ink composition the polyolefin wax and an liquid dispersion containing particles of an ethylene polymer composition are also set forth. |
